Details on study design: HPLC method:
HPLC CONDITIONS
- Column: Lichrospher 100 CN, 250 x 4 mm, 5 µm
- Column temperature: 35 °C
- Eluent: 0.01M citrate buffer pH 6 / methanol (50 : 50 (v/v))
- Flow rate: 1.0 mL / min
- Injection volume: 50 µL
- Detector: RI-Detector Temp. = 40 °C, SR2, Sens. 64

REFERENCE ITEMS
- The following reference items were used: Sodium nitrate p.a., Acetanilide p.a., Naphthalene, Phenol, Phenathrene, Linuron and Methylbenzoate. See 'Any other information on materials and methods incl. tables' for the determined retention time of the reference items.

Description of key information

The Koc was determined to be 51.3 L/kg (log Koc 1.71) in a GLP-compliant OECD 121 study. Adsorption to the solid soil phase is not expected.

Key value for chemical safety assessment

Additional information

The adsorption behaviour of the substance was determined in a study according to OECD TG 121 (HPLC method) and in compliance with GLP criteria (BASF, 2017). In this study solutions of reference substances with known log Koc values based on soil adsorption data and the test substance were analysed by HPLC using a Lichrospher 100 CN column. The log k’ values of reference substances were plotted against the known log Koc values. The log Koc value for the test substance was calculated by substituting its mean log k’ in the calibration curve. Under the conditions of the test, the Koc of the substance was determined at 51.3 L/kg (log Koc = 1.71).
